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 120 Minutes |
Ready In: 140 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
Mexican shredded pork filling, use it in tacos, tamales, or burritos. Ingredients:
1 pound boneless pork shoulder |
1 clove garlic, crushed |
1 onion, cut into 4 wedges |
1 carrot, peeled and cut into 1 inch pieces |
1 celery, cut into 1 inch pieces |
1 tomato, chopped |
1 tablespoon chili powder |
1 teaspoon salt |
1/4 teaspoon cumin |
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ano |
1/4 teaspoon pepper |
1 bay leaf |
Directions:
1. Place pork, garlic, onion, carrot, celery, and tomato in a saucepan. Season with chili powder, salt, cumin, oregano, pepper, and bay leaf; add enough water to cover. Bring to a boil, then reduce to a simmer. Cover and simmer until pork is tender, about two hours. Cool and shred. Use in tacos or tamales. |
